Easterseals Northeast Indiana, a non-profit healthcare and human services provider, has confirmed a data security incident involving unauthorized access to its systems. This event, which occurred on September 4, 2025, has led to concerns that personal information maintained by the organization may have been compromised.
If you have received a formal data breach notification letter from Easterseals Northeast Indiana, it means their investigation suggests your personal information was part of this unauthorized access. It is crucial to review this letter carefully, as it will contain specific details about what information was involved and any identity monitoring services being offered.
In the wake of such an incident, recipients of breach notices should remain vigilant. Beyond reviewing the notification letter, consider closely monitoring your financial accounts and credit reports for any unusual activity. Being proactive can help detect and mitigate potential misuse of your exposed data.
